1.The unit of power is joule.

Ans- False.

The unit of power is watt.

2.Mechanical energy cannot be converted into electrical energy.

Ans-False.

Mechanical energy can be converted into electrical energy.

3.Work is a vector quantity.

Ans-False.

Work is a scalar quantity.

Work is a scalar product of force and displacement.
